Top Solar Providers in Rocklin: Just How to Select the Right Solar Company Near You

Rocklin is a sensible solar market. Long, bright summer seasons, increasing energy costs, and a big share of single-family homes make roof solar a severe consideration rather than a lifestyle accessory. But the component that journeys individuals up is seldom the modern technology itself. Panels are fully grown. Inverters are well recognized. Manufacturing price quotes are simple to create. The tough part is choosing amongst the several solar suppliers competing for the exact same roof.

If you have actually invested whenever searching for solar firms, solar business near me, or solar power business near me, you have actually possibly observed the pattern. Every supplier asserts costs devices, expert installation, fast allowing, and exceptional financial savings. Theoretically, they all audio similar. In practice, the distinctions show up in agreement terms, panel layout choices, responsiveness during allowing, handiwork on the roof covering, and what happens 2 years later if your inverter throws a mistake code on a Friday afternoon.

For homeowners in Rocklin, the best selection is generally not the firm with the flashiest ad or the lowest heading price. It is the installer that can design around your specific roofing system, clarify the business economics clearly, established sensible assumptions, and still address the phone after PTO. That appears obvious, but it narrows the field quicker than lots of people expect.
Why Rocklin property owners come close to solar in different ways now
A few years earlier, several property owners went solar with a basic goal: erase the electric expense. The mathematics has actually become more nuanced. Energy rate frameworks, internet payment changes, and the growing role of battery storage space mean system style now matters as much as raw panel count. A firm that was "adequate" when every proposition was just a bigger variety at a reduced cents-per-watt price may not be the best fit today.

Rocklin sits in a climate where cooling can drive heavy summertime usage. That develops a mismatch many households recognize well. Solar generates greatest during warm mid-days, but the highest-value electrical power can move into later hours, particularly in homes with time-of-use plans. A high quality installer ought to not just ask just how much electrical power you utilized in 2015. They should ask when you utilize it, whether an EV is coming, whether the pool pump runs in peak home windows, and whether backup power matters to your household.

That discussion separates salesmanship from actual system design.

I have seen house owners select the cheapest bid, just to find out later on that the provider ignored shielding on one roofing aircraft, undervalued future intake, or packed too many panels on the less eye-catching side of your home due to the fact that it simplified installment. A lower quote can still be the best quote, however just if the design stands up under scrutiny.
What sets strong solar business in Rocklin apart
The far better solar companies Rocklin house owners wind up recommending have a tendency to share a handful of traits. They are not always the largest firms, and they are not constantly local-only either. What issues much more is whether they have constructed a reputable operating process for Northern California conditions.

A strong installer will certainly begin with the roof, not the financing pitch. They would like to know age, material, blockages, air flow, and circuit box details before making huge claims regarding financial savings. If your roofing system has ten years left, a credible company will certainly state that re-roofing prior to installation may conserve cash and headache over the life of the system. The less credible variation will certainly wave it off and hope you take care of it later.

They likewise recognize regional permitting realities. Rocklin tasks move with utility evaluation, municipal approval, and evaluation, and each phase can produce hold-ups if documents is sloppy. Business that set up in the area routinely tend to prepare for these rubbing factors. They understand what plan sets need to be total on the first pass. They recognize which circuit box upgrades tend to trigger included testimonial. They know just how to set up around inspection traffic jams instead of promising an impractical install-to-activation timeline.

Plenty of solar providers are highly attentive throughout pricing quote and oddly inaccessible once the system is on the roofing. The companies that earn lasting count on reward commissioning and post-install service as part of the product, not an afterthought. That matters due to the fact that solar is not a one-day transaction. It is a 25-year possession attached to your home.
The local-versus-national question
Many homeowners begin with a simple assumption: regional business care extra, national companies have much more resources. There is some fact in both ideas, yet neither tells the entire story.

A local installer frequently has the advantage of knowledge. They might understand common Rocklin rooflines, HOA concerns in particular neighborhoods, and usual utility upgrade concerns in older homes. Their sales procedure can really feel a lot more grounded due to the fact that the individual reviewing your residential property most likely comprehends regional problems firsthand. If something goes wrong, there is additionally comfort in understanding the solution team may be based within driving distance.

National brand names, on the other hand, can bring more powerful funding connections, larger devices accessibility, and extra formalized job systems. Some are exceptional. Some are rigid and impersonal. Their regional efficiency usually depends much less on the logo design and even more on whether the real layout, permitting, and set up teams offering your location are consistent and accountable.

The clever action is not to pick based upon company dimension alone. Judge the office, team, and process that will certainly manage your job in Rocklin. A national business with a regimented regional team might surpass a small local installer that is stretched slim. The reverse can additionally be true.
What to take a look at before you contrast prices
Price matters, but solar quotes can be engineered to look less expensive without being much better. A lower system expense might reflect smaller countered, lower-efficiency modules, confident production presumptions, or financing terms that include substantial long-lasting expense. When people compare quotes just by monthly repayment, they typically miss the actual economics.

Here is where to slow down and look much more meticulously:
system size in kW and approximated yearly production in kWh panel and inverter brands, plus guarantee terms for both tools and labor roof design, including which airplanes will be used and just how shading was modeled financing structure, dealership fees, interest rate, and any kind of escalator if it is a lease or PPA timeline assumptions for permitting, setup, PTO, and service response
Those five points reveal greater than a shiny savings sheet ever before will.

For example, two companies might each propose a 7.2 kW system, yet one estimates meaningfully higher annual outcome. That could be because one makes use of an extra beneficial azimuth, one thinks much less shading, or one is merely extra hostile in software application. Ask them to discuss the distinction. A great response will certainly reference roofing system planes, tilt, seasonal solar access, and expected clipping habits if suitable. A weak solution typically appears unclear fast.
The funding conversation most sales associates hurry through
Financing has actually become the area where numerous solar deals look much better than they are. That does not indicate funded solar is a bad concept. It suggests house owners require to recognize what they are signing.

A cash money purchase remains the clearest alternative if you can manage it. It gives you the easiest repayment calculation and prevents finance fees. However not everybody wants to bind that much resources in one home renovation project, particularly when roofing work, a/c replacement, or an EV purchase may also be on the horizon.

Loans vary extensively. Some use appealing month-to-month settlements since the dealership cost is huge and built into the job price. Others bring higher visible passion however reduced overall financed price. If a salesperson concentrates just on "replacing your energy costs with a lower solar repayment," press for the complete repayment quantity over the complete term. The regular monthly framework is not ineffective, but it hides also much.

Leases and power purchase arrangements should have even better reading. They can fit particular house owners, particularly those focusing on reduced upfront price, yet you need to understand whether the payment rises annually, just how transfer functions if you market the home, and what takes place if production underperforms. A lease that looks manageable in year one can really feel very different in year fifteen.

In Rocklin, where lots of house owners are long-lasting locals yet resale still matters, transferability ought to never ever be brushed aside. A cleanly owned system is commonly simpler to describe throughout a home sale than a contract the customer must presume, though regional market conditions can influence how much of a concern that becomes.
Why storage transforms the conversation
Battery storage space is no longer an edge add-on. For some households, it is main to making solar job well under present energy structures. But it is not immediately the ideal response for everyone.

If your main goal is backup power for failures, storage has a clear value that can not be decreased to straightforward utility cost savings. If your goal is time-shifting power into evening usage, a battery can enhance the business economics of self-consumption. If your spending plan is limited and interruptions are unusual in your component of town, beginning with solar alone may still be reasonable, offered the system is developed with future storage space compatibility in mind.

The installer's role right here is essential. Some solar companies push batteries since the ticket dimension rises. Others avoid them since design and allowing obtain more complex. Neither prejudice offers the property owner. You desire a firm willing to model both scenarios honestly. What adjustments in repayment? What loads can actually be supported? Is the entire house covered, or a protected lots panel? Those information matter a great deal more than the battery's brand in a sales brochure.

I have actually seen a lot of confusion around "whole-home backup." In many cases, what homeowners think of and what the electrical design supports are not the same. A seasoned installer will walk you with real tons monitoring. They will certainly discuss what starts, what runs continually, and what have to remain off unless additional storage space capacity is added.
Roof problem, electrical service, and the hidden expense drivers
Not every solar quote captures the complete scope of the job. Some of the most common price surprises have little to do with panels.

Older roof coverings are the initial concern. If your composition roof shingles roofing is near the end of its helpful life, installing solar on top of it might be shortsighted. Eliminating and re-installing panels later includes cost and coordination. A credible carrier should not treat roof covering age as a side note. They should elevate it early and review whether solar must comply with a reroof.

Main circuit box are one more constant variable. If your electric panel is obsoleted, undersized, or already crowded, you may require upgrades prior to interconnection. That can materially impact task expense and timeline. The aggravating component is that some proposals stay unclear concerning panel work until late at the same time, when the homeowner feels dedicated. Ask early whether the quote thinks any kind of solution upgrade, subpanel modifications, or breaker derating.

Then there is attic room accessibility, conduit transmitting, and visual execution. A technically competent system can still look sloppy if conduit runs are improperly intended or roof ranges are outlined without regard to symmetry. That might seem cosmetic, but home owners care deeply concerning aesthetic allure, and resale buyers do also. The most effective solar companies think through both performance and appearance.
Questions worth asking every installer
When home owners compare solar business near me, they usually inquire about panel brands first. There is nothing incorrect keeping that, but it needs to not be the opening up question. You will certainly discover more by asking how the firm manages the task as a whole.
How do you represent seasonal shading and production uncertainty in your estimate? Who deals with permitting and affiliation, your in-house team or a third party? What labor warranty do you supply, and that services the system if something fails? If my roof or panel requires additional job, when will certainly I understand and exactly how will certainly rates be handled? Can the system be increased later for an EV, battery, or boosted family load?
These questions disclose just how fully grown the business is operationally. They also make it harder for a weak sales process to remain on script.

Pay close attention to how straight the answers are. Obscure confidence prevails in this market. Specificity is rarer and more valuable. If a representative can not explain service duty, rise terms, or most likely timeline variability, that works information.
How to review reviews without being misled
Online assesses assistance, however they need analysis. The majority of solar firms build up first-class comments instantly after installation, when the sales and set up groups have been most noticeable. What testimonials typically stop working to capture is year-three service high quality. Did the business respond when monitoring went offline? Did they process a guarantee case efficiently? Did they guarantee roof covering infiltrations if there was a leak concern?

Look for patterns instead of separated praise or complaints. If several reviewers discuss solid interaction throughout permitting, that is a good indicator. If numerous people describe lengthy silence after finalizing, take it seriously. A single angry testimonial regarding scheduling might indicate really little. 10 remarks regarding invoicing complication or hard-to-reach service personnel suggest something else.

It likewise aids to see whether the company responds openly in a calmness, valid method. Defensive or evasive actions can tell you as high as the initial complaint.
The equipment concern, simplified
Homeowners can obtain lost contrasting module performance percentages and inverter specifications to the 2nd decimal location. Tools matters, but only within reason. A lot of recognized panel brands and inverter manufacturers currently offer efficiency that is more than appropriate for a well-designed property system.

The much better question is whether the devices option fits your roof covering and use. A roof covering with numerous planes and partial shading might benefit from module-level power electronics. A broad, unshaded south- or west-facing roof may work well with an easier architecture. If you are considering storage space, compatibility issues. If aesthetic uniformity issues, all-black panels might deserve the small premium for you.

What should make you stop briefly is not that one business supplies Brand A and one more offers Brand name B. It is when the salesman can not describe why that equipment was selected for your property specifically.
Common mistakes Rocklin house owners make when working with solar providers
The initially mistake is dealing with every quote as interchangeable. They are not. Behind similar system dimensions can be very different assumptions and obligations.

The second is making a decision as well swiftly due to a limited-time promo. Genuine solar value originates from the system's long-lasting efficiency, not from a pitch developed around necessity. If the quote is excellent on Tuesday, it will usually still be excellent after you have had time to examine production quotes, funding, and warranties.

The 3rd is stopping working to think past existing usage. A house that adds an EV, electrical water home heating, or office devices can outgrow a firmly sized system earlier than anticipated. Great installers talk with most likely future load adjustments. Wonderful ones design around them when the spending plan allows.

The fourth is forgeting business stability. Solar is a long-horizon acquisition. A generous labor guarantee implies less if the installer disappears. That does not suggest only big companies are safe, yet it does suggest you need to ask how much time they have run, who executes service, and what assistance looks like if tools makers call for control later.
How to narrow the area with confidence
If you are significant regarding finding the ideal solar firm near you, get three proposals that are meaningfully equivalent. Ask each company to price estimate similar balanced out targets, note whether storage is consisted of or optional, and discuss any kind of presumptions that influence result. This reduces the chance that proposition shows up less expensive merely because it does less.

After that, spend much less time on branding and more time on the real handoff factors. That evaluates the roof covering? That creates the strategy established? Who pulls permits? Who sets up? Who troubleshoots? Firms that handle these steps cleanly have a tendency to provide cleaner projects.

If one supplier attracts attention because they asked smarter concerns, identified roofing or panel issues early, and did not oversell the economics, that is usually worth something. In solar, proficiency typically seems much less amazing than marketing. It is still what you want bolted to your roof.
What a good final decision looks like
A solid solar decision in Rocklin is seldom about chasing the absolute most affordable rate. It has to do with picking among solar companies with a clear understanding of design high quality, long-term support, funding framework, and neighborhood execution. The right business should make the process really feel extra concrete as you move on, not more confusing.

By the time you authorize, you need to understand what your system is anticipated to produce, what it will set you back in complete, how it will certainly be mounted, what takes place if something goes wrong, and whether the style fits just how your home in fact utilizes power. If any one of those responses still really feel fuzzy, keep asking questions.

<h1>Is solar still worth it in Rocklin in 2026?</h1>

Solar can still be financially worthwhile in 2026 when electricity savings over time exceed installation and financing costs. Current local pricing averages about $2.46 per watt, with system economics depending on electricity usage, roof conditions, utility rates, and system size. Battery storage can increase self-consumption but adds to the upfront cost. The financial return varies significantly between households.

<h1>Why is it difficult to sell a house with solar panels in Rocklin?</h1>

Selling a home with solar panels can be more complicated when the system is leased, financed, or covered by a power purchase agreement. Buyers may need to assume or qualify for an existing contract, adding additional steps to the transaction. Owned systems with clear documentation are generally simpler to transfer. System age, roof condition, and remaining warranty coverage can also affect buyer decisions.

<h1>How much is a solar system for a 2000 sq ft house in Rocklin?</h1>

A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$12,000 to $25,000 before any applicable incentives, depending on the required capacity. Home size alone does not determine system size because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, panel wattage, electrical upgrades, and battery storage can substantially affect the price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.

<h1>Why is my electric bill so high if I have solar panels in Rocklin?</h1>

An electric bill can remain high when household electricity consumption exceeds the amount generated by the solar system. Nighttime use, air conditioning, seasonal production changes, shading, or equipment problems can increase electricity purchased from the grid. Fixed utility charges may also remain even when solar offsets much of the home's electricity use. Comparing solar production with utility consumption can help identify the cause.

<h1>What is the biggest drawback of solar panels in Rocklin?</h1>

The upfront installation cost is one of the biggest drawbacks of residential solar panels. Electricity production also varies with sunlight, weather, shading, and roof orientation. Battery storage can provide electricity when solar generation is low, but it significantly increases system cost. Roof work and eventual equipment replacement can create additional expenses.
